The Armenian side has not assumed any unilateral obligations to clarify the fate of the missing, Armenian Foreign Ministry spokesman Vahan Hunanyan told Radio Azatutyun.
“Both in the first and the second Artsakh war, the Armenian side has missing persons. We attach importance to finding out the fate of the missing. In this sense, the Armenian side did not assume any unilateral obligations,” he said.
After returning eight Armenian prisoners of war, Azerbaijan said that in exchange it expects to receive information about the Azerbaijani soldiers and civilians killed in the first Karabakh war and presumably buried in mass graves, as well as the location of these graves.
